Lundgren made an earlier movie about mercenaries called Men of War. It's a little zany, but it's worth checking out if you're into those old(er) action movies that have a lot of running and gunning. It takes place on this island that's being assaulted by an opposing group of guns for hire and Dolph pretty much destroys all of them (and half the island). It's one of his better performances though and he's got a weird little group of mercs helping him.

Twitter update.
ok now that I found mywallet, had a beignet and some jambalaya and found a space in theproduction office I am ready to roll. The cast, with the exception ofSly, arrives in NoLa over the next few days. Next Friday we have allthe boys on one set -Sly, Jason, jet, randy, Dolph,Terry and Mickey –should be pretty cool Mickey works for 2 days. Arnold will shoot hisscene in LA on a date TBD. We start shooting on Monday at the LouisianaFilm Studios in Harahan – pretty impressive I must say. And while manyof our locations are practical (in and around NoLa’s central businessdistrict) we have several days of stage work as well. Yesterday Sly wason Canal Street where he took possession of his newest baby – a 2006tricked out to the max Ford Mustang GT convertible. Sweeet is anunderstatement. Some of the folks passing by were shocked when theyrealized it was Sly standing there admiring his new wheels. Prettycool. I spoke to WWL a local radio station and told them how excited weare to be here in the Big Easy…and we are. Other than that I amcounting the hours til Monday. Hopefully by then I can release the nameof the actor playing Church. Off to a production meeting then I gottasee Star Trek tonight!!! oh BTW…Terry Crews character name has revertedto the original – Hale Cesear…bye bye Jazz Gumbo. And Jet Li’scharacter name is not Ping Pong…whew.
